Although the usual visual features for ID can`t be seen, after conversation with Dr. Martin Hauser, it is considered best to place this in Syrphus ribesii as identified by DNA in Bold Systems. However, all Bold identifications should be treated individally as sometimes the database used is not always guaranteed, as we have found...

Bold Systems mentions the dis
Bold Systems mentions the distribution of micotrichiae on the wing and hairs toward tip of hind femora as identifying features. Did you check these features?

Syrphus .... male
There are insufficient features to identify to species. Safe in Syrphus.

 
Ok
BOLD results on this one:
All 99 closest matches are for ribesii: 3 at 100%; remainder ranging from 99.83% down to 99.31%.
